Clean People Feel Morally Superior

A new study shows that people feel morally cleansed when they are physically clean, and as such are more inclined to judge others more harshly. The study conducted by Chen-Bo Zhong at Northwestern University found that “participants who cleansed their hands before rating the social issues judged these issues to be more morally wrong compared to those who did not cleanse their hands.”

Those who had a self-image of cleanliness and purity made more harsh moral judgements on social issues. Crucially, this association was entirely mediated by their having an inflated sense of moral virtue compared with their peers. "Acts of cleanliness have not only the potential to shift our moral pendulum to a more virtuous self, but also license harsher moral judgment of others," Zhong concluded.
